Routine Maintenance Practices for YE3 Motors

Start with visual inspections to check for dirt, corrosion, or loose connections. Clean the motor regularly to avoid overheating, and ensure proper ventilation. Lubricate bearings as per the manufacturer's guidelines to reduce friction and wear. Monitor vibration levels using tools; excessive vibration can indicate misalignment or bearing issues. For brake motor and explosion-proof motor types, extra care is needed—inspect brakes for wear and verify explosion-proof seals to maintain safety standards.

Advanced Upkeep for Specialized Motor Types

When dealing with a variable frequency motor, focus on the drive system. Check for harmonic distortions and ensure cooling fans are functional, as variable speeds can increase heat. For explosion-proof motor upkeep, regularly test enclosures and gaskets to prevent hazardous sparks. Common Issues and Troubleshooting Tips

Common problems include overheating, often due to blocked vents or overloading. Address this by cleaning and reducing load if necessary. Noise or vibration may signal bearing wear or imbalance—replace bearings promptly. Electrical faults, like insulation breakdown, require testing with a megohmmeter. For brake motor issues, check brake pads and adjust tension. Always consult your motor manufacturer for specific troubleshooting guides to avoid costly repairs.

Frequently Asked Questions

How often should I perform maintenance on a YE3 motor?

It depends on usage and environment. Generally, conduct visual checks monthly, lubrication every 6-12 months, and comprehensive inspections annually. High-duty applications may require more frequent upkeep.

Can I use generic parts for YE3 motor upkeep?

It's best to use parts recommended by your motor supplier or manufacturer to ensure compatibility and safety. Generic parts might not meet efficiency standards, risking motor damage.

What are the signs that a YE3 motor needs immediate attention?

Watch for unusual noises, excessive heat, or sudden power drops. These can indicate serious issues like bearing failure or electrical faults that require prompt action to prevent breakdowns.

How does upkeep differ for a variable frequency motor?

Variable frequency motors need additional checks on the drive and cooling systems due to speed variations. Monitor for voltage spikes and ensure proper grounding to protect sensitive components.
